DTE Goa - The Directorate of Technical Education (DTE) was established in 1986 under the Government of Goa, which is headquartered in Bardez. The Directorate was established by the government to introduce new technical, medical institutes, and courses in the state of Goa. The technical or medical education in the state is facilitated by the boards of education under the state of Goa. The competent authority DTE Goa is also responsible for conducting the centralized counselling for granting admission to affiliated technical, professional, or medical institutes to the students of the state of Goa.
This Story also Contains
DTE Goa is also responsible for preparing the budget, distributing the funds for regulating education in the state. Under the rules and regulations of the statutory bodies like AICTE, PCI, COA, etc., as approved by the State Government, DTE Goa uses to manages and controls all the technical, professional, or medical institutes and education in Goa. Only on the basis of the medical entrance test conducted at the national level by the competent authorities, the medical admission in the state is granted by DTE Goa. Aspirants have to apply separately under the state competent authority for taking the medical admission in the state. Aspirants fulfilling the eligibility criteria will be required to fill the application form within the due date specified by DTE Goa. The Goa MBBS application form can be downloaded in an online or offline mode both but required to be submitted in the offline mode. In order to fill the DTE Goa admission form, aspirants can go through the below-mentioned steps.
Visit the official website, dte.goa.gov.in
Download the application form in PDF format
Fill the application form by writing name, gender, Aadhar card details, contact number, and DOB correctly.
Affix two recent passport-size photographs, of which one is to be attached with the application form and the other on the acknowledgment card.
Candidates will have to submit the duly filled application form to the state counselling authority with a Demand Draft of the application fee.
Aspirants are then advised to take a confirmation page from the respective authorities for future references.

On the basis of the successful filling of the application form, DTE Goa uses to release the merit list in online mode at its official website. The merit list of DTE Goa includes the names of applicants who are eligible for the further admission process.
The Goa merit list includes all the necessary details such as registration number, categories, candidate’s name, gender, Class 12 roll number and score, birth date, NEET score, qualifying scores, and eligibility status of the applicant. However, the merit list of postgraduate medical admission indicates the name of candidate, state merit rank, NEET PG rank, date of birth, and percentile scores. Only aspirants whose names will appear on the merit list are invited to participate in the counselling.
For both UG and PG medical admission in the state, DTE Goa is the competent authority to release the cutoff. For only qualified aspirants, DTE will release the NEET cutoff Goa. In order to take admission, the cutoff comprises the last rank and the equivalent scores obtained by the aspirants in the entrance exam, on the basis of which admission will be granted.
Applicants can go through the below-mentioned factors on which the cutoff for medical admission in Goa depends.
The total number of candidates who appeared for the entrance exam.
The level of difficulties in the question paper.
The availability of seats for admission.
DTE Goa is the competent authority to conduct centralized counselling for granting medical and dental admission offered by the affiliated institutes under this directorate. As per the previous trends, the mode of the conduction of both UG and PG counselling is online. Only aspirants whose names will be included in the merit list can participate in the Goa counselling process. DTE will conduct a total of three rounds of counselling, including a mop-up round.
Candidates are required to give their preferences for college and course at the time of counselling. On the basis of choices filled, availability of seats, state merit rank, and other determining factors, medical admissions will be granted by authorities. In order to complete the admission process, aspirants who will be allotted seats in a particular round will be required to report at the allotted institutes after the seat allocation.
